13-year-old boy, allegedly armed, killed by police

A 13-year-old boy apparently brandishing a gun was shot dead by police in New York City – and the entire violence was caught on camera.

The footage opens with three police officers running down a street after the teenager in the upstate city of Utica on Friday evening.

Officers caught up with the boy and wrestled him to the ground in a residential area. One officer can be seen standing over the boy outside a house and punching him as he lay on the lawn. There was a brief scuffle before one of the officers shot the boy.

As the chaos unfolded, neighbors stood outside their homes filming the incident with their cellphone cameras. They can be heard reacting in horror after the gunshot. One person yelled, “Oh my God! Yo! He just shot her!”

The teenager was rushed to hospital, where he died of his injuries.

In a statement posted on Facebook, Utica police officials said officers arrested two juveniles as part of an investigation. But the 13-year-old fled on foot and officers chased him as he appeared to pull out a gun, police said.

This led to a confrontation during which the officer discharged his weapon, killing the boy.

Authorities have now launched an investigation into the police-involved shooting.
